The 431039-B21 - HP InfiniBand 1 x Port 4x DDR PCIe Host Card Adapter delivers a specialized connection solution aimed at enhancing data transfer speeds in server environments. It fits into PCIe slots and enables efficient, low-latency communication, making it a practical component for networked computing systems. |

The 431039-B21 is a high-performance InfiniBand host card designed to provide robust data communication capabilities. It is often found in server and storage setups requiring fast, low-latency connections. Built for data centers and enterprise IT environments, this adapter supports users seeking reliable interconnect solutions to enhance network throughput and scalability. Key Features
